int jg=72;//設置一個增加的時間
datetime dt=convert.todatetime("2006-4-23 12:22:05");// 設置一個初始化的時間
datetime newdt=dt.addhours(jg);//初始化時間加上增加的時間
datetime nowt=datetime.now;//現在的時間
response.write("現在時間是:"+nowt+"<br>");
response.write("數據庫時間是:"+dt+"<br>");
response.write("新的時間是:"+newdt+"<br>");
if(newdt<nowt)//如果相加后的時間大于現在的時間
{
response.write("可以");
}
else//否則
{
response.write("不行");
}
解決下面這個投票系統間隔時間的方法:
http://thcjp.cnblogs.com/archive/2006/04/20/380169.html
今天在看asp.net完全手冊這書的時候發現的這個方法,忙著學習,懶得修改,如果有朋友覺得有必要就自己去改好了,修改方法就是把vote.aspx.cs 的load事件下面的時間判斷修改下,然后在數據庫中把vlog表中的dtime字段屬性設置為 datetime 屬性就可以了,呵呵!!
新聞熱點
疑難解答